In recent weeks I have experienced what I would personally described as discrimination and intimidation!
As a person living with, a disability I am dependent upon my service provider to provide every aspect of my personal support requirements.
Lately, that organisation has been threatening to withdraw some service provision based on “unavailability of staff” and “industrial regulations”
My recent experience highlights the urgent need for a National Disability Insurance Scheme, that places Australians living with disability and their family’s right in the centre of service provision so that we can take control of our own lives and become active and equal citizens of the communities in which we live, work and volunteer
